    Hey Team We are coming to Disneyland for Valentines tines week and Sweethearts night the 13th. Looking foward to trying the different fried chicken plates, but was wondering if any restaurants in the park or Downtown Disney have Monte Criscco sandwiches?

    Unfortunately, the famous Monte Cristo sandwich isn’t available in Downtown Disney District restaurants, but don't fret! You’ll find this delicacy where it belongs- in New Orleans Square. Last year, my husband and I shared a Sweethearts’ Nite themed meal at Café Orleans, where the Monte Cristo is normally served, and it was nothing short of magnifique!

    The Blue Bayou Restaurant is another romantic spot that serves Monte Cristos and is likely to be open during this Disneyland After Dark event. There’s something so swoon-worthy about dining under twinkling fireflies while drifting boats from Pirates of the Caribbean glide by. Dining reservations are now open for the date that you’re planning to visit, and since Valentine’s week is so popular, I’d recommend booking a table as soon as possible if that’s where you’d like to dine. And believe me, if you’re determined to try that Monte Cristo, the dreamy atmosphere of Blue Bayou will perfectly complement your fairy tale evening.

    Finally, be sure to keep a close watch on the Disney Parks Blog. Specialty food offerings for Sweethearts’ Nite will be announced any moment now, and these culinary creations are always crafted with a sprinkle of pixie dust and a whole lot of love. From heart-shaped treats to themed plates that celebrate Disney couples, there’s bound to be something deliciously romantic to enjoy alongside your quest for fried chicken plates.
